How they compare

China currently reports 1.61 million against 89,400 in France, a difference of 1.52 million.

That makes China's figure about 18.0 times France's.

Across all 35 years both countries report, China has been ahead every year.

China ranks 1st and France ranks 4th of 235 countries.

China has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
